Today we head to Xishuangbanna, where the mountains are covered with endless tea fields.


Enter Xishuangbanna and visit the Jingzhen Octagonal Pavilion, which was built during the Kangxi period and is an ancient Buddhist building.

After visiting the Bajiao Pavilion, we came to Mandiu Village in Gasa Town, Jinghong City, Xishuangbanna. It is a primitive small village of the Dai ethnic group that has existed for thousands of years.
